28 MLAs Taken Oath To Become Ministers In MP Cabinet

In the recent cabinet expansion in Madhya Pradesh, 28 BJP leaders, including six ministers of state and four state ministers, were sworn in.

This marks the first expansion of Chief Minister Mohan Yadav’s government. Notable leaders, Kailash Vijayvargiya and Prahlad Singh Patel, took the oath as ministers. The move reflects the party’s efforts to strengthen and diversify its leadership in the state.

MP Governor Mangubhai Patel Administered the Oath

Today, MP Governor Mangubhai Patel appointed 28 ministers, including six with independent charge and four state ministers in MP cabinet. They took the oath of office in a ceremony.

List Of Ministers In MP Cabinet

Rakesh Singh, Rao Uday Pratap Singh, Karan Singh Verma, Nagar Singh Chauhan, Samapatiya Uike, Eidal Singh Kansana, Pradyuman Singh Tomar, Inder Singh Parmar, Nirmala Bhuria, Tulsi Silawat, Vijay Shah, Vishwas Sarang, Govind Singh Rajput, Narayan Singh Kushwaha, Rakesh Shukla, and Chetan Kashyap were sworn in as cabinet ministers, in addition to Vijayvargiya and Patel.

Radha Singh, Pratima Bagri, Dilip Ahirwar, and Narendra Shivaji Patel took the oath as Ministers of State.

Krishna Gaur, Dharmendra Lodhi, Dilip Jaiswal, Gautam Tetwal, Lakhan Patel, and Narayan Panwar were sworn in as Ministers of State (Independent Charge).

Mohan Yadav As CM Of MP

Mohan Yadav became a surprising choice for the position of Madhya Pradesh’s Chief Minister, taking over from four-time CM Shivraj Singh Chouhan.

The BJP selected Yadav to counter dissatisfaction among voters leading up to the 2024 general elections. Additionally, the party sought to gain support from the significant OBC community with this strategic move.
